Apple is about to break its oldest laptop rule — no touchscreen — and charge you handsomely for the privilege. According to Bloomberg’s Mark Gurman, the rumored OLED “MacBook Ultra” will ship with M5 Pro and M5 Max chips, the same custom silicon already powering the MacBook Pro lineup announced in March 2026. The value proposition here isn’t about raw computing muscle. It’s about display, design, and touch input — a luxury play wearing a spec sheet as a disguise.

What’s Actually New Here

OLED, touchscreen, and Dynamic Island arrive on Mac — but the processor inside stays familiar.

Strip away the chip question and genuine novelty remains. Gurman’s reporting describes tandem OLED panels in 14-inch (codenamed K114) and 16-inch (K116) configurations, delivering the kind of contrast and HDR brightness that makes current mini-LED screens look like they’re squinting. A full touchscreen — designed to complement, not replace, keyboard and trackpad — marks the first time Apple has allowed fingers on a Mac display. Dynamic Island migrates from iPhone, replacing the notch with a functional UI element for alerts and camera activity. The rumored launch window falls between late 2026 and early 2027, though Apple has made no official announcement.

The M5 Pro delivers up to a 15-core CPU with 307 GB/s memory bandwidth. The M5 Max scales to a 40-core GPU, 614 GB/s bandwidth, and 128 GB unified memory — genuinely capable hardware built on TSMC’s 3nm process using Apple’s Fusion Architecture. That said, it’s identical to what already sits inside a MacBook Pro starting at $2,199, per Apple’s March 2026 pricing. Any performance difference between today’s MacBook Pro and the OLED model will come down to thermal design and power limits, not the chip itself.

If you’re eyeing this machine for AI-heavy workflows, patience pays. The M7 Pro and M7 Max generation — reportedly tuned for intense AI workloads, according to Gurman — is the planned successor targeting around late 2027. Early adopters of the first OLED MacBook are buying a screen and a chassis. The silicon leap comes with the next model.

What This Costs You

Premium pricing for a premium display — with performance you can already buy for less.

Current M5 Max MacBook Pros top out at $3,899 for the 16-inch. Unofficial estimates for the OLED model range from $2,499 at entry level to over $4,000 for top configurations — none confirmed by Apple. It’s the iPhone Pro Max pricing playbook applied to laptops: the same core experience, wrapped in better materials, sold at a steeper price because the premium finish is the point. You’re not paying too much for speed you don’t already have. You’re paying for the screen you’ve always wanted on a Mac.
